Irish Apple Crumble
- pastry dough, to fit an 8-inch pie pan
- 4 medium granny smith apples or 4 medium Red Delicious apples, peeled,cored,and coarsely chopped
- 3/4 cup sugar, plus
- 1 tablespoon sugar
- 1/2 teaspoon cinnamon
- 1/2 cup all-purpose flour
- 4 tablespoons unsalted butter, softened
- Preheat the oven to 350u0b0F.
- Line an 8-inch pie pan or heatproof baking dish with the pie dough; prick the dough with the tines of a fork.
- In a bowl, mix together the apples, 1/4 cup of the sugar, and 1/4 teaspoon of the cinnamon.
- In a second bowl, mix together the flour, 1/2 cup of the sugar, and the unsalted butter; work these ingredients together with a fork until you have a crumbly mixture.
- Fill the pie crust with the apple mixture and smooth over the surface.
- Spoon the crumble over the apple mixture so that the apples are completely covered.
- Sprinkle the remaining tablespoon of sugar and 1/4 teaspoon of cinnamon over the crumble.
- Bake for 25 minutes.
